Posted on 01/07/2025
Now, you can have a virtual office anywhere, but choosing one of the prime locations like Mayfair automatically sets you up for a greater chance at success. Being based out of one of the world’s most forefront cities is always going to be a boon, and Mayfair is right at the heart of it all.
There are so many reasons that having a virtual office in Mayfair can boost your remote work setup. Here are the top ones to consider for your operations today:
Being based out of a major city automatically raises the prestige of your brand simply because of the association potential clients, customers, or business partners have with that city. Just like with all cities, however, some postcodes mean something, and some don’t. Choosing the right postcode is easy when you opt for a virtual office in London.
If you want to make a name for yourself in finance, then you’ll need to base your operations in London’s business district, Canary Wharf. For businesses that want to head into the luxury sector, however, there’s no better place than Mayfair.
Mayfair is home to the original Rolls Royce showroom. It’s the location of some of the biggest names in the hotel industry, like Claridge’s and The Ritz London. If you want to gain luxury business connections or make a name for yourself in the business of luxury, Mayfair is the prestigious location that will help you set the right tone for your operations.
When you set up a virtual office, you also give your business a home – virtually, yes, but a home all the same. This means that you can benefit from the professional business support offered by the City of Westminster, who provide several notable programs that you can use to boost your remote work setup as soon as you register your virtual office London Mayfair location.
Inclusive Growth London is a programme designed to provide support to micro and small businesses, especially those owned by women and/or disabled people. There are also possible grants and funding opportunities available by registering for a free account (you’ll then be given access to the grand and funding search feature). There is also the Kensington, Chelsea, and Westminster Chamber of Commerce, which is an independent business network you can use to make key connections in the boroughs.
One of the major benefits of having a virtual office in Mayfair is the ability to turn that virtual space into a physical one when and if you need it. All you need is to make sure that the virtual office in Mayfair that you choose offers meeting rooms for rent. This way, you can enhance your professional image by organising meetings at your stunning Mayfair address, all while saving on rent.
Virtual offices in London often come with extra support services that you can add to your bundle. You can boost your remote work setup with a professional phone number and answering services, including call forwarding, answering, or patching. Other critical services include mail receiving. At a minimum, for example, you need to ensure that the office can accept letters from Companies House, though you may also wish to add on mail services to accept letters or even packages from other sources.
Every reputable and worthwhile virtual office also offers physical office space. This means you may be able to later on add coworking spaces to your bundle, book meeting rooms, or even open up a physical presence in that space. Flexibility is essential when it comes to carefully steering your business toward success, and virtual offices in Mayfair offer the prestige and amenities to help.
One of the biggest reasons to choose a virtual office London Mayfair location is the proximity to some of London’s biggest luxury brands – without needing to immediately open up an office or showroom in the area yourself. You can make a day trip into the city to attend events, take meetings, or build partnerships while having access to coworking space or a meeting room with fast Wi-Fi and other amenities. Business success comes from who you know, so it’s best to locate your business where you want to be known.
Privacy is your most important commodity. Having a professional business address in London means that your private residence, and the fact that you work from home, stays private. To truly keep your private and professional life separate, however, remember the importance of call patching or forwarding when choosing a virtual office. Your clients, customers, or business partners will see your professional front, and you can separate your private life from your business.
One of the biggest reasons to choose one of the top virtual offices in London is because it’s simply very cost-effective. For a small amount per year, you can benefit from a prestigious Mayfair address and then only pay extra for the physical space if and when you need it, allowing you to streamline your operations and make the most out of your startup capital or revenue streams as you grow.
A virtual office in Mayfair lets you tack on essential services with the prestige of one of London’s most infamous postcodes. Add to that the fact that you can take advantage of networking opportunities and business support options while keeping your private life private, and you have a winning combination that can help boost your remote work setup at a minimal cost.
Or, Request a Call Back: